Re: [Users] Error while executing action Setup Networks
Also, I noticed that the interface for assigning virtual networks to physical interfaces does NOT work correctly in the latest version of google chrome. I had to flip into firefox ... I'm not sure if that is documented any where. Well, google chrome is not officially supported browser. It works more or less, but you can not rely on it. The supported browsers are: On Linux the Firefox 17 and on Windows IE = 9. Web admin should have shown you a warning message that the current browser is not supported. But after a quick look at the wiki I did not find any mention about it. We should definitely add it somewhere, I'll try to find a suitable place.
